Full ingredients (from label)

Bolognese Pasta (54%) (Bolognese (66%) (Crushed Tomato (36%), Beef (25%), Water, Onion, Carrot, Corn Starch, Celery, Canola Oil, Red Wine, Beef Gelatine, Tomato Paste, Crushed Garlic, Stock Powder, Basil, Salt, Sugar, Black Pepper, Chilli Powder, Dry Rosemary, Ground Bay Leaf), Cooked Pasta (33%) (Macaroni (Wheat), Water, Salt), Basil)Cheese Filling (12%) (Milk, Cheese Powder (Milk), Parmesan Cheese (Milk), Mozzarella Cheese (Milk), Butter (Milk), Wheat Flour, Crushed Garlic, Salt, Beef Gelatine, Spices)Batter (Water, Wheat Flour, Cornflour (Wheat), Guar Gum, Salt, Black Pepper)Crumb Blend (Wheat Flour, Dehydrated Vegetables, Salt, Herbs, Canola Oil, Yeast Extract, Yeast, Sugar, Wheat Gluten, Natural Colours (160c, 100), Water)Wheat FlourCanola Oil.
